2026.04.2910:41:47UTC+00Portugal Unemployment Holds at 5.8% in March

Portugal’s unemployment rate held steady at 5.8% in March 2026, remaining just above the record lows reached in late 2025. A persistent gender gap continued to characterize the labor market, with unemployment among women at 6.3% compared with 5.3% for men. The adult unemployment rate edged up to 5.0%, from 4.7% recorded between November 2025 and January 2026, while youth unemployment fell to 18.1%, its lowest level since October 2022. The total number of unemployed increased by 2,400 to 328,400, even as employment rose by 4,900 to 5.30 million. Both the employment rate (65.7%) and the labor force participation rate (69.8%) were unchanged. The broader labor underutilization rate—which encompasses the unemployed, marginally attached workers, and underemployed part-time workers—stood at 9.8%.
